ABSTRACT
In this article, a new kind of starch sizing agent, cationic graft [CS-g-P(AM-co-HEMA-co-BA)] was synthesized. Its structure identified by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R). The results experiment show that polyester/cotton blended yarn (T/C 55/45) sized with exhibits better tensile strength, abrasion resistance and lower hairiness counts than PVA.
